Let's Pool Forces To End Killings

We have commented on Gender-Based Violence (GBV) several times, but the issue seems to be getting worse by the day. There seem to be a number violent crimes, which most of the times, lead to fatalities, some of which are crimes of passion.

Many non-governmental organisations, have over the years pooled their limited resources to fight the GBV scourge, but the war seems to be far from over, as crimes of passion seem to escalating, and murder cases emanating from other circumstances. There seem to be moral degeneration, a problem, which a number of leaders have talked about at great length to no avail.  Where did we go wrong as a society?

Have adults forsaken their duty to be good role models to the youth? It is high time the issue of the ever increasing murder cases in the country is given the due attention it deserves. All need to come together to address this very painful issue, before it spirals out of control.
